What Is Plastic 6?
Plastic #6 is polystyrene, a lightweight, rigid material often used for takeout containers, disposable cups, cutlery, and Styrofoam trays. Its low cost and insulating properties make it a favorite for restaurants and packaging manufacturers.
| Property | Description |
|---|---|
| Resin Identification Code | #6 |
| Chemical Name | Polystyrene (PS) |
| Common Uses | Coffee cups, food trays, egg cartons |
| Texture | Brittle, lightweight |
| Heat Resistance | Low – starts softening around 212°F (100°C) |
While it performs beautifully for cold food and insulation, heat changes everything.
Is Plastic 6 Microwave Safe?
In short: No, Plastic 6 is not microwave safe.
When exposed to microwave heat, polystyrene can warp, melt, or leach harmful chemicals such as styrene into food. Styrene is a possible human carcinogen, linked to nervous system damage and hormonal disruption in long-term exposure.
Think of it like this: microwaving Plastic 6 is like heating wax paper on a skillet—it wasn’t built to withstand that temperature, and what melts may end up where it doesn’t belong: in your meal.
Why Plastic 6 Fails in Microwaves
1. Low Melting Point
Polystyrene softens quickly under heat. Even reheating soup for 30 seconds can distort the shape of a container.
2. Chemical Leaching
Microwave energy excites molecules unevenly, creating hot spots. These stress points can release toxic compounds that migrate into your food, especially oily or acidic dishes.
3. No Structural Integrity
Unlike plastics labeled #2 (HDPE) or #5 (PP), which are designed to handle moderate heat, Plastic 6 breaks down easily, leaving behind a brittle mess or melted residue.
Safer Alternatives to Plastic 6
| Material Type | Microwave Safe? | Notes |
|---|---|---|
| Glass | Yes | Best for heat retention and safety |
| Ceramic | Yes | Avoid metallic paint or rims |
| Plastic #5 (Polypropylene) | Usually | Check for “Microwave Safe” label |
| Silicone | Yes | Flexible, durable, heat-resistant |
| Plastic #6 (Polystyrene) | No | Avoid heating altogether |
When in doubt, transfer food to a glass or ceramic dish before reheating. The convenience of microwaving plastic isn’t worth the potential health trade-off.
The Health Risks of Microwaving Plastic 6
1. Styrene Exposure
According to the National Institutes of Health (NIH), chronic exposure to styrene can affect the central nervous system, leading to headaches, fatigue, or memory issues.
2. Endocrine Disruption
Certain compounds in Plastic 6 can mimic estrogen, disrupting hormone balance and possibly impacting fertility over time.
3. Environmental Persistence
Polystyrene doesn’t biodegrade easily. When disposed of improperly, it breaks into microplastics that infiltrate waterways and soil—creating a chain reaction from kitchen to ecosystem.

Frequently Asked Questions (FAQ)
1. Can I microwave Styrofoam cups?
No. Styrofoam is Plastic 6, and it can melt or leach chemicals when heated. Always pour your drink into a microwave-safe mug first.
2. What happens if I accidentally microwaved Plastic 6?
A short exposure might not cause visible harm, but avoid eating food that smells odd or has melted plastic residue. Discard it for safety.
3. How do I know if plastic is microwave safe?
Look for the microwave-safe symbol (wavy lines) or a #5 (PP) label. When in doubt, switch to glass.
4. Why do restaurants still use Plastic 6?
It’s cheap, lightweight, and insulating, making it perfect for takeout—but not for reheating. Businesses value cost, but consumers must prioritize safety.
5. Can Plastic 6 release toxins even without melting?
Yes. Even at moderate temperatures, chemical migration can occur, especially with fatty or acidic foods.
